Product description Employing a more environmentally-friendly battery chemistry than previous iterations Celestron's PowerTank Lithium 86.4 Wh Power Supply gives you the power required to run your motorized Celestron mount with the added capability of charging small electronics such as smartphones, tablets, and cameras. An integrated white LED flashlight, with two output settings, gives you the illumination you need to get to your observation point and set, and a separate red LED light allows you to perform tasks like swapping eyepieces or attaching filters without affecting your night-adjusted vision. The PowerTank has a compact form factor at 7.5 x 3" and weighs in at just 2.25 pounds. Two straps are included so you can either hang it or attach it to the tripod, but if you want to leave it on the ground it has an IP65-rating making it dustproof and water-resistant. - Battery

Technical parametersCelestron 18771 Specs | Battery Chemistry | Lithium Phosphate (LiFePO4) | | Capacity | 86.4 amp hr | | Charge Time | 3 h | | Inputs | 1 x 16 VDC, 2000 mA charging port | | Output | 1 x USB port, 5 VDC 1000 mA 1 x USB port, 5 VDC 2100 mA 1 x 12 VDC Celestron telescope power port White LED light Red LED light | | Weatherproofing | IP65-rated, Dust-proof and weather-resistant | | Dimensions | 7.5 x 3.0" / 19.1 x 7.6 cm | | Weight | 2.25 lb / 1.0 kg | | | | Package Weight | 3.65 lb | | Box Dimensions (LxWxH) | 9.9 x 8.0 x 3.95" |
